JESD204A data converters cut power, board space in high-speed data apps

Norwood, Mass.— Analog Devices Inc. (ADI) has started to sample a pair of low-power, high-speed 14-bit ADCs (analog-to-digital converters) that incorporate the JESD204A data converter serial interface standard.

The JESD204A standard was developed to allow designers of high-speed communications and data acquisition systems to extend transmission lengths while improving signal integrity and simplifying printed-circuit board layout. The AD9644 dual and AD9641 14-bit 80 MSPS (mega samples per second) ADCs use half the power of competing products and 25 percent less board area, according to ADI.

The AD9644 consumes 423 mW at 80 MSPS and features a multi-stage, differential-pipelined architecture with integrated output error correction logic. At 70 MHz and 80 MSPS, the AD9644 achieves an SNR (signal-to-noise ratio) of 73.7 dBFS and an SFDR (spurious-free dynamic range) of 92 dBc.

The JESD204A industry serial interface standard reduces the number of data inputs/outputs between data converters and other devices, such as FPGAs. Fewer interconnects simplifies layout and allows smaller form factor realization without impacting overall system performance. These attributes are important for a range of high-speed applications, including portable instrumentation, ultrasound equipment, radar, wireless infrastructure (GSM, EDGE, W-CDMA, LTE, CDMA2000, WiMAX, TD-SCDMA), and software-defined radios.

NXP is another chip vendor that offers high-speed data converters, which support the JEDEC JESD204A serial interface standard. NXP's JEDEC-based data converters include two analog-to-digital converters (ADCs)—the 12-bit ADC1213Dxx and 14-bit ADD1413Dxx— and a digital-to-analog converter (DAC), the DAC1408D650. The AD9644 is available in a 48-lead LFCSP (7 mm x 7 mm) and is specified over the industrial temperature range of -40°C to +85°C. 

Pricing: In 1ku quantities, the AD9644 is $37 each, and the AD9641 is $26.35.

Availability: Sampling.
